## Releases

The v2.4.1 release fixes the stale-cache bug covered in last week's postmortem. Short version: the Pellwick edge nodes served expired manifest entries for up to six hours because the invalidation hook silently failed when the upstream fetch timed out. We now fail loud and purge on timeout. If you're on call and see cache-age alerts, roll forward, never back. All release artifacts must be verified before deploy using the key below.

signing key of bagap-yawep = bky13_TbfT6ZMUoGJo2

Heads up for folks new to the Quillbase repo: our SQL linter (`sqlsift`) is stricter than it looks. It flags unqualified column refs, bans `SELECT *` outside scratch dirs, and enforces a max statement length so migrations stay reviewable. Don't fight it with inline disables — if a rule genuinely doesn't fit, raise it in review and we'll adjust the thresholds project-wide. Most of the knobs you'd care about are numeric limits, and they're centralized. Here's the current set.

constants for tafog-kahag:
RATE_LIMITS = {
    "sorir": 697,
    "oliox": 683,
    "holax": 176,
    "casox": 60,
    "pelius": 382,
}

Welcome to the Tindergate team! Our internal API gateway, Corvelle, rate-limits every upstream service, and most of its behavior is driven by environment variables rather than config files. RATE_WINDOW_SECONDS and BURST_ALLOWANCE are the two you'll tweak most often — don't set the burst above 200 unless the traffic team signs off. Everything lives in the standard env file checked into the secure bundle. Once you've set the limits for your local stack, the gateway's admin token is set on the very next line.

vault entry, kafog-yahop: COURIER_KEY8=0faa53ae